## Changelog — Pondrel v3.2.0

Default database connection pooling values changed in this release. The pool now starts smaller and grows on demand, which reduces idle connections against the Kestrelby cluster. If you joined after the v3.1 freeze, note that overrides in older deploy scripts are ignored. The current defaults are as follows.

settings of fafog-haduf:
ZORIX_PIN=4648
ZORIX_METRICS_HOST=metrics.zorix.paliqsys.corp
ZORIX_LOG_LEVEL=info
ZORIX_TENANT=druix

TURN-208: Gatevale turnstile counters at the Merrow Field pilot double-count when a rotation reverses mid-cycle. Attendance totals drift roughly 2% high per event. The debounce window fix is implemented, reviewed by Ilsa, and soak-tested across two simulated match days without drift. Ready for your cut; the candidate build is identified below.

trace token, tagag-tafog: htk6_5ed18c

Runbook: Tilebox cache layer. On cache-miss storms, check the Quarrystone renderer pool first; if saturation exceeds 80%, scale workers before touching TTLs. Eviction policy is LRU with a 6h ceiling — do not raise it, the Maplewright tiles go stale fast. Purge via the admin CLI only. Redeploys require the cache signing credential in the env file. Add it on the next line.

sealed setting: ARCHIVE_KEY3=8d0